It was good, but I always had a real problem with people not turning up. I think that because it was free, it led some people to think that it didn’t matter if they didn’t pick it up. If you stick it on eBay with a small price, it will be collected.
And this is why I always mark stuff on Facebook Marketplace with like a $5 price tag. I fully intend on giving it away for free, but the small price weeds out all of the people who only sort by “Free” and mass message every single poster.

Why? I dont like reading articles
The “Buy Nothing Project”, a group that started the fad, is asking Facebook to take down groups using their name.
The “project” makes money off buy-nothing exchanges through their app.
